Hi Laura,
I have a problem with very bitter greens myself and so have never actually bought argula, but I have seen chefs on foodtv./etc. make a pesto out of it. They process it with other fresh/dried herbs, garlic, a little olive oil, nuts (pine or walnut) and some parmesean/romano cheese. Then serve over pasta and veggies, use as a salad dressing, etc. Just a thought!

Laura,

You could try lightly stir frying it in a little olive oil, like one might do with other leafy greans like kale or shard. That might take some of the "bite" out of it. I'm a fan of bitter greens myself. I also like to put arugula on pizza, like you might do with spinach.
